24W7 d sub solder cup power and signal connector

The 24W7 D-Sub solder cup connector combines power and signal contacts in a single compact design, making it ideal for complex, space-saving applications. All contacts are precision-machined and gold-plated, ensuring maximum durability, conductivity, and long-term reliability in harsh environments. The power contacts support current ratings from 10A to 40A, while the signal contacts offer versatile configurations for efficient data and power transmission.

 

Widely used in industrial automation, military electronics, test equipment, and power distribution systems, the 24W7 combo D-subminiature connector provides a rugged, high-performance solution for demanding electrical designs. Material Insulator material PBT+30% G.F (UL94V-O)
Insulator color Black/Blue (can be customized)
Contacts material Copper alloy
Contact plating Gold finish over nickel
Shell material Steel/SPCC-SD, nickel or tin plated
Electrical The working voltage 300V AC
High power contact current rating 10, 20, 30, 40 A (can be customized)
Connector with signal contact current rating 3 A
Contact resistance 2.7 milliohms max
Insulation resistance 2000 megaohms min
Mechanical Dielectric withstanding voltage 1000 v AC for 1 minute
Insertion force ¢1.0 :0.6~2 N /Pin

¢3.6:2~7 N /Pin

Extraction force ¢1.0:0.2 N /Pin MIN

¢3.6:0.5 N /Pin MIN

Durability 500 cycles
Operating temperature -55°C to +105°C
